Descripción

In episode 2 of The Artistic Mind Podcast, we have a conversation with the one and only Ameer Corro. Ameer is a YouTuber, musician, storyteller, and so much more. In this episode, we explore Ameer's journey through all of these creative realms, including his relationship with music, his life philosophy, and why he chose to quit TikTok after gaining 100K subscribers in 6 months. TAMP #1: What is creativity?—Amal Irgashev and Hahnlin Noonan

In this episode of our podcast, we, your hosts, open the curtain on our individual journeys towards mastering creativity. Introducing ourselves and the core mission behind our show, we dive deep into our personal experiences with artistry and the struggles we faced along the way. One of us, a classically trained musician, speaks candidly about the constraints of a traditional musical education. With an emphasis on technical proficiency and precision, she explains how classical music schools often overlook the essence of creative interpretation, limiting personal style and self-expression. Contrasting this structured upbringing, our second host, a self-taught artist, shares her unique journey of creative discovery. She underscores the struggles she faced developing technical skills but celebrates the freedom it allowed her for creative exploration. Discussing the essential role of discipline and perseverance, she reveals her routine of spending the first, often frustrating, hour of her creative process setting up for a breakthrough in the flow. We both share our ongoing voyage to overcome creative struggles, emphasizing the importance of silencing the inner critic and battling negative self-talk. We acknowledge that creativity is deeply personal and diverse for everyone, and there's no 'one-size-fits-all' solution.
